Alexzandria currently ranks #13929 among girls' names in America, with 1,749 babies recorded since 1981.

According to the U.S. Social Security Administration, Alexzandria has been recorded 1,749 times among girls since 1981, currently ranked #13929 nationally and more common than 21% of girls, with its heaviest use in the 2000s. This profile covers year-by-year birth trends, decade totals, and state-level distribution, all derived directly from SSA birth-registration files spanning 1981 to 2025.

Alexzandria's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Divide Alexzandria's SSA record in two at 2004 and the more recent half accounts for 40% of all births, the earlier half the remaining 60%, consistent with a name more common in the past than in recent years. Its calmest year was 2024, with only 6 births recorded -- set against the 2003 peak of 94, that's the full swing in one name's fortunes.

Frequently Asked Questions

How popular is the name Alexzandria?
1,749 babies have been named Alexzandria since 1981. It currently ranks #13929 among girls. The peak year was 2003 with 94 births.
When was Alexzandria most popular?
Alexzandria was most popular in the 2000s decade with 700 total births. The single peak year was 2003.
Where is Alexzandria most popular?
The top states for the name Alexzandria are California (171 births), Texas (112 births), Florida (64 births).
How long has the name Alexzandria been used?
Alexzandria has been recorded in Social Security data since 1981, spanning 45 years of data through 2025.
What names are similar to Alexzandria?
Names with a similar sound or spelling include Alexis, Alexandra, Alexa, Alexandria, and 4 more. These share a common prefix and are also used for girls.
